Output ee3fa04333f51b7855d2929f3ae08990b5889215e4e5a7613f41c4e273a07cba:7

value
698000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1273329987027bfe646228add709170408a62ae4 OP_EQUAL
address
33Na6525Hx4MUXWQzawaQeSvaNXVZkuVxZ
transaction
ee3fa04333f51b7855d2929f3ae08990b5889215e4e5a7613f41c4e273a07cba
spent
true